Job Summary

Under the direction of the Executive General Manager – Freight Services, the Freight Coordinator’s position is to support the freight operations teams by way of monitoring the daily load activities through managing relationships with carriers, customers, suppliers, and vendors ensuring that goods are picked up and delivered on time. Receiving order requests at various stages and processing to complete the service offering.

Job Responsibilities:
  • Secure freight by calculating and quoting competitive rates to the customer (FTL & LTL)
  • Coordinate shipments through communication with the shipper, consignee, and dispatch to the carrier to facilitate a problem‑free transaction.
  • Facilitate freight movement through use of one‑shot carrier negotiations and/or use of existing carrier rate contracts, skills related to using various freight matching web tools including Link Logistics.
  • Identify and recommend policies to maximize revenues and minimize operational costs.
  • Instrumental in team‑based strategic business planning, working with freight team and management to achieve business development goals.
  • Identify existing client growth, opportunity, and exposure for vertical integration.
  • Negotiate Rail intermodal, FTL and LTL buy rates with carriers.
  • Negotiate and Quote Rail intermodal, FTL and LTL rates to the clients.
  • Monitoring a variety of shipments, ensuring they meet obligations of movement.
  • Retrieve appropriate carrier reference numbers for tracking and tracing.
  • Confirmation of charges on all applicable Rail, Road FTL and LTL carrier shipments.
  • Order closure and hand‑off to the accounting department.
  • Bill Clients according to pre‑arranged rate structures or spot quotes for inbound, outbound, etc.
  • Investigate and process freight claims as required.
  • Ensure the timely and accurate completion of a variety of reports.
  • Involvement in updating and maintaining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) related to client service.
